Tata Technologies’ Use Of AI/ML To Cut Power Usage
Tata Technologies is enhancing its manufacturing processes with artificial intelligence and machine learning, aiming to reduce downtime and pollution. The company is also consistently implementing new technologies, as explained by Yogesh Deo, Senior VP and Delivery Head, Engineering Research and Development.
A year-long study of process data revealed that by using AI/ML models, power consumption was reduced by 18%, process quality improved, fuel consumption was reduced by 10%, and chemical consumption was reduced by 8%. The use of AI has also helped identify anomalies, reducing downtime on the shop floor. For example, a paint shop blower can be halted if one fails, causing 7-8 hours of repairs. By detecting anomalies just before the failure or shutdown, the company can take corrective action immediately, Yogesh Deo, Senior VP and Delivery Head, Engineering Research and Development explained.
AI has also been used to predict tooling failure in the case of dye design. A model can be prepared to predict whether the dye will perform optimally or fail by comparing historical operational data with current data. This correlation between operational data and failure cases helps determine the remaining useful life of the dye.
